  13. When compiling g++ programs with -p, I get a lot of undefined
  14. profiling-symbols if I use gcc 2.2.2. (Stuff like LBB20, LBE21, ...).
  15. g++-1.41 works well in the same situation.
  16.  
  17. Which option or library did I forget?
